What Causes Scratches on Cutlery
Scratches are often caused by friction, stacking, aggressive dishwashing, and abrasive cleaning tools. While stainless steel is durable, it is not invulnerable. Improper handling, such as throwing items into a sink or using rough scouring pads, accelerates surface damage. Additionally, harsh dishwasher detergents can wear away protective coatings over time.
Even premium brands like laguiole debutant cutlery are susceptible to surface scratches if not handled carefully. Preventive practices and proper cleaning methods are crucial to maintaining the aesthetic appeal of cutlery.
Steps to Fix Minor Scratches
Minor scratches on stainless steel cutlery can be removed using polishing compounds. Apply a small amount of non-abrasive stainless steel polish with a soft cloth, moving in the direction of the grain. Rinse thoroughly and buff with a microfiber cloth. For deeper scratches, a fine grit sandpaper or commercial polish kit may be used cautiously.

Preventive Measures for Future Use
Preventing scratches is better than curing them. Avoid stacking cutlery, use gentle sponges for cleaning, and organize storage using properly sized trays. Do not mix stainless steel with aluminum or other metals in the same washing load to prevent chemical reactions and friction-based wear.
When possible, hand-wash your high-quality cutlery and dry immediately. A consistent routine will help retain the elegance and functionality of your utensils.
